Smith Works was formed in 2024 by Sophie Smith.

Sophie began consulting in July 2019 as a copywriter, designer and content creator. She now collaborates with art directors, individual artists, designers, luxury brands, cultural organisations and academic institutions to devise strategies for varied creative projects.

Prior to 2019, Sophie worked in public relations and communication, initially for a London daily newspaper and later for arts, architecture and design organisations. From 2011 to 2018, she worked with the late Professor William Alsop OBE RA, helping to form his multidisciplinary studio, aLL Design, in 2012.

Sophie graduated from UAL with a BA (Hons) degree and her early career as a costume and set designer spanned 15 years. She freelanced for BBC Television, the National Theatre, Channel 4, the Arts Council, Walt Disney Theatrical, the British Council and New Millennium Experience Company, NMEC (The Millennium Dome).

Sophie taught English as a foreign language with the British Council in Cairo (2010-2011) and has since studied English literature, creative writing and in 2023, the history of Late Medieval and Early Modern London (1450 - 1550).

She also practices as a visual artist. Her first group show, Shared Landscapes, took place at Hypha Studios, Hastings, in October 2024.
